CRC

De CiberWiki
Control redundancia ciclica (o CRC)

CRC (Control de redundancia cíclica), es la técnica de Control de errores que emplea el concepto de polinomio generador como divisor de la totalidad del contenido, el resto de esta operación se enmascara con una secuencia determinada de bit y se envía en este campo.


Se trata entonces de una división binaria, en la cual se emplea como polinomio generador justamente el CRC-32, que figura en la imagen de abajo, por lo tanto el resto de esta división SIEMPRE será una secuencia de bit de longitud inferior a 32 bits, que será lo que se incluye en este campo.

CRC-32

Los formatos estandarizados de estos CRCs son los que se presentan a continuación:

  • CRC-12:X12 +X11 +X3 +X2 +X+1 • CRC-16:X16 +X15 +X2 +1
  • CRC CCITT V41: X16 + X12 + X5 + 1 (este código se utiliza en el procedimiento HDLC)
  • CRC-32(Ethernet):=X32 +X26 +X23 +X22 +X16 +X12 +X11 + X10 +X8 +X7 +X5 +X4 +X2 +X+1
  • CRCARPA:X24 +X23+X17 +X16 +X15 +X13 +X11 +X10 +X9 + X8 +X5 +X3 +1

En nuestro libro Seguridad por Niveles que puedes descargar gratuitamente desde nuestra web DarFe.es encontrarás desarrollado el tema en el:

CAPÍTULO 4: El nivel de ENLACE


Puedes ver los siguientes videos sobre este tema en:
Nombre del video Enlace
🌐 Aprendiendo Ciberseguridad paso a paso
Charla 11: El nivel de Enlace (Introducción)
🌐 Aprendiendo Ciberseguridad paso a paso
Charla 12: El nivel de Enlace (Tiempo de Ranura)
🌐 Aprendiendo Ciberseguridad paso a paso
Charla 13: El nivel de Enlace (Funcionamiento de Ethernet)
🌐 Aprendiendo Ciberseguridad paso a paso
Charla 14: El nivel de Enlace (Dominios de Colisión)
🌐 Aprendiendo Ciberseguridad paso a paso
Charla 15: El nivel de Enlace (Formato de trama Ethernet)
🌐 Aprendiendo Ciberseguridad paso a paso
Charla 16: El nivel de Enlace (CRC)